What is fracture external fixation?

External fixation of fracture is a method to treat fracture. By fixing the bracket outside the fracture site, the bone can be restored to its normal position and kept still, thus accelerating the process of fracture healing.

3. The curative effect of fracture external fixation.

Compared with traditional plaster fixation, external fixation of fracture can promote blood circulation at fracture site, reduce muscle atrophy and avoid limb dysfunction and wrist contracture.

The treatment time of fracture external fixation is relatively short, and physical therapy and sports rehabilitation training can be carried out during the treatment to promote the patient's physical recovery.
